背景概述:近期有用户报告在iPhone 8(以下简称“苹果8”)上使用的TP钱包(TokenPocket 或简称TP)“突然不可用”。本说明旨在从区块链节点层、公链代币层、数据可用性、全球化数字技术影响、合约日志取证到专家评析报告的结构化建议,给出排查路径与应对建议。
1. 表象与初步判断
- 表象包括:APP 启动崩溃、同步失败、RPC 请求返回超时或错误、资产显示异常、交易广播失败或交易在链上无法确认。不同表象指向不同层级的问题:本地兼容性、网络/节点、链上数据或第三方服务中断。
2. 验证节点(Validator / RPC 节点)层面
- 节点不可用或响应不稳定会造成钱包同步失败、余额不显示或交易无法构造。需确认:TP 是否使用自家节点、第三方节点(Infura、Alchemy 等)或用户可选节点。排查步骤:查看钱包日志中的 RPC endpoint、错误码(如-32000、timeout)、在其他设备或使用 curl/postman 直接请求节点基础接口(eth_blockNumber, net_version)检测响应。
- 节点类型问题包括:节点升级/硬分叉不同步、被网络防火墙或 CDN 拦截、证书/TLS 兼容问题(iOS 版本对 TLS 版本敏感)。
3. 公链币与代币层面
- 代币合约如果发生升级、迁移或被合约管理员暂停/冻结,会导致资产显示异常。检查代币合约是否被提现限制、是否有大规模 token transfer 或黑名单操作。
- 代币价格显示或交易对接的第三方 oracle 服务异常也会让用户误判“不可用”。建议通过链上浏览器(Etherscan、BscScan 等)直接查询合约状态与交易记录。
4. 数据可用性(Data Availability)问题
- 数据可用性指链上数据是否完整可获取。对以 rollup 或分片架构的链,DA 层若出现缺包会导致链上状态不可证明或节点拒绝提供历史数据,钱包无法查询交易历史或证明余额。
- 排查方法:查看区块头、交易回滚/reorg 日志、检查是否存在长期未被打包的交易、对比不同 RPC 节点返回的历史交易等。
5. 全球化数字技术与运营影响
- 全球化影响包括:某些国家/地区对加密服务的监管封锁、CDN 节点路由问题、App Store 的地区差异以及 iOS 系统更新导致的兼容性问题。苹果8 运行较旧 iOS 版本时,更易受系统 API 变化影响(例如 TLS、加密库、网络权限变化)。

- 建议:确认 AppStore 是否下架、确认地域限制、使用 VPN 或更换网络测试是否为网络路由问题。
6. 合约日志与链上取证
- 合约日志(events)是判断资产被动向、合约异常行为的重要证据。排查应收集:事务哈希、区块高度、相关事件(Transfer、Approval、OwnershipTransferred 等),并导出合约调用堆栈(若可用)。
- 日志保存路径:钱包本地日志、RPC 请求/响应记录、区块链浏览器的事件索引。采集时注意时间戳、设备信息与操作步骤以利复现与法律取证。
7. 故障排查流程(建议)
- 步骤一:本地检查——更新 TP 到最新版,重启设备,检查 iOS 版本与网络权限。导出钱包助记词/私钥前请做好离线备份。
- 步骤二:网络与节点检测——使用其他网络(蜂窝/Wi-Fi),切换或手动配置 RPC 节点,尝试公链浏览器查询同一地址。
- 步骤三:链上数据核验——查询交易哈希与代币合约事件,核对余额变动与交易状态(pending/failed/success)。

- 步骤四:日志与取证——导出 APP 日志、RPC 返回、合约事件,保存截图与时间线,必要时提交给钱包团队与区块链分析机构。
8. 专家评析与建议
- 可能原因排序:节点/RPC 服务中断、iOS 与 APP 的兼容性问题、区域网络/监管拦截、代币合约异常、数据可用性层面短期故障。专家建议优先检查 RPC 可达性与链上事件,因为这些最直接决定资产可见性与交易广播。
- 应对建议:在短期内,用户应导出私钥并在受信任环境或替代钱包(支持相同链的开源钱包)中恢复以确认资产安全;长期则建议钱包开发方增强多节点容灾、优化 iOS 兼容测试、提供更友好的离线导出/恢复指引,并建立全球化运维监控与法务合规通道。
结论:苹果8 上的 TP 钱包“突然不可用”通常是多因素叠加结果,系统性排查需从验证节点、链上数据、合约日志与全球网络环境同时进行。通过结构化取证与专家分析,可以定位故障根源并减少用户资产与信任损失。
评论
crypto小白
按照步骤排查后发现是RPC节点的问题,换节点就恢复了,感谢这篇说明。
Alex_Chain
很全面,尤其是数据可用性部分,很多人忽视了Rollup/DA层的影响。
蓝墨水
建议再补充如何安全导出助记词的具体操作,防止二次损失。
NodeHunter
可以把常用RPC检测命令列出来,方便快速定位,谢谢作者。
陈博士
专家评析中提到的多节点容灾非常必要,运营方应优先实现。